The living room is often the central gathering place in a home, and the windows in this room can greatly impact the overall look and feel of the space. Choosing the right window treatments for your living room can make a big difference in the ambiance and functionality of the room. From sheer curtains to elegant shutters, there are many options to consider. Here are the top 10 window treatments for your living room.Window Treatments for Living Room
Window coverings are a popular choice for living rooms as they provide both style and function. Roman shades are a great option for a classic and sophisticated look. They come in a variety of colors and patterns and can be easily raised or lowered to control light and privacy. Roller shades are another versatile option that can be customized to fit your living room's decor. They offer a clean and modern look and are easy to operate.Living Room Window Coverings
If you're looking for a more traditional look for your living room, wood blinds or faux wood blinds may be the way to go. These shades offer a warm and inviting feel and are available in a variety of finishes. Cellular shades, also known as honeycomb shades, are another popular choice for living rooms. They provide excellent insulation and come in a range of colors and patterns to match your decor.Living Room Window Shades
For a more customizable option, vertical blinds are a great choice for living rooms with large windows or sliding glass doors. They can be easily adjusted to control light and privacy and come in a variety of materials, from fabric to vinyl. Aluminum blinds are also a popular choice for living rooms as they are lightweight, durable, and affordable.Living Room Window Blinds
Curtains are a classic and versatile option for living room window treatments. They come in a variety of fabrics, patterns, and lengths, allowing you to customize the look of your living room. Sheer curtains are a great choice for adding a touch of elegance and softness to your living room. They allow natural light to filter in while still providing privacy.Living Room Window Curtains
If you want to make a statement with your living room window treatments, consider drapes. They come in a variety of luxurious fabrics and can add drama and sophistication to your living room. Velvet drapes are a popular choice for a touch of opulence, while linen drapes offer a more casual and airy look.Living Room Window Drapes
For a finishing touch to your living room windows, consider adding valances. These decorative pieces are typically hung above the window and can add a pop of color or pattern to your living room. Scarf valances are a popular choice for a soft and flowing look, while box pleat valances offer a more structured and tailored appearance.Living Room Window Valances
If you have large or irregular-shaped windows in your living room, window panels may be the best option for your window treatments. They can be custom-made to fit your windows and come in a variety of fabrics, colors, and patterns. Silk panels offer a luxurious and elegant look, while cotton panels provide a more casual and relaxed feel.Living Room Window Panels
For a more simple and understated look, sheer window treatments are a great option for living rooms. They offer a soft and ethereal feel to the room and can be layered with other window treatments for added privacy and insulation. Lace sheers are a popular choice for a feminine and romantic touch, while linen sheers provide a more natural and organic look.Living Room Window Sheers
If you're looking for a more permanent and durable option for your living room window treatments, shutters are a great choice. They come in a variety of materials, including wood, vinyl, and composite, and can be easily customized to fit your windows. Plantation shutters are a popular choice for their classic and timeless look, while café shutters offer a more casual and relaxed feel.Living Room Window Shutters
